What Does a Mortgage Lender in Jordan Cost?
Typical costs for a mortgage lender in Minnesota include an origination fee of 0.5% to 1% of the loan amount, appraisal fees of $400 to $700, and title insurance of $1,000 to $2,000. Closing costs generally range from 2% to 5% of the purchase price. This is general information, not mortgage or financial advice.

Frequently Asked Questions
What documents do I need to apply for a mortgage in Jordan Minnesota?
You typically need pay stubs, tax returns, bank statements, and proof of identification. Minnesota lenders may also require a certificate of compliance for certain loan programs.
How long does the mortgage process take in Minnesota?
The process usually takes 30 to 45 days from application to closing. Minnesota law allows a three-day rescission period for refinances but not for purchase loans.
Are there first-time homebuyer programs in Minnesota?
Yes, the Minnesota Housing Finance Agency offers programs like the Start Up and Step Up loans. These provide down payment assistance and competitive rates for eligible buyers in Jordan.
